The FPC Visual Inspection Equipment Market grew from USD 1.10 billion in 2025 to USD 1.18 billion in 2026. It is expected to continue growing at a CAGR of 7.53%, reaching USD 1.83 billion by 2032.

FPC visual inspection equipment is becoming the backbone of quality, traceability, and fast-ramp manufacturing in a world of tighter designs

Flexible printed circuits (FPCs) sit at the intersection of miniaturization, mobility, and high-density interconnect design. As device makers push thinner stacks, tighter bend radii, and higher I/O counts, inspection requirements are becoming less forgiving. Visual inspection equipment for FPC manufacturing has therefore shifted from being a downstream quality gate to an upstream enabler of stable process capability, supporting rapid feedback loops across imaging, etching, lamination, coverlay, and final assembly.

At the same time, the definition of “visual inspection” has expanded. What once relied primarily on operator microscopes and rule-based camera systems is now increasingly shaped by high-resolution multi-spectral imaging, defect libraries tuned to FPC failure modes, and AI-driven classification that adapts to changing designs. This evolution is being reinforced by growing expectations for traceability, audit-ready documentation, and consistent inspection performance across multi-site production.

Against this backdrop, buyers are evaluating more than raw detection sensitivity. They are weighing how inspection platforms integrate with manufacturing execution systems, how quickly recipes can be created for new designs, how robust false-call control is in high-mix environments, and how maintenance and calibration practices sustain performance over time. The competitive advantage is moving toward manufacturers that can scale inspection sophistication without slowing throughput or inflating total cost of ownership.

The inspection landscape is shifting toward connected, AI-augmented quality systems that prioritize throughput, certainty, and lifecycle resilience

The landscape is undergoing a series of transformative shifts driven by both product design and operational realities. First, FPC geometries are becoming more complex, including finer conductor spacing, smaller vias, and more intricate coverlay and stiffener interactions. As a result, inspection systems are expected to detect defects that are subtler in appearance yet more consequential in performance, such as micro-cracks near bend zones, marginal etch profiles, or partial opens that only manifest after repeated flex cycles.

Second, manufacturers are moving from isolated inspection islands to connected quality ecosystems. Inspection data is increasingly treated as a process signal rather than a pass/fail artifact. This shift is accelerating the adoption of closed-loop control concepts where inspection outputs guide upstream parameter tuning, support root-cause analysis, and strengthen statistical process control. In practice, the value of an inspection platform now depends heavily on its data structure, interoperability, and the maturity of its analytics layer.

Third, the balance between speed and certainty is being recalibrated. High-throughput lines cannot tolerate heavy re-inspection burdens, but downstream escapes are costly, especially where FPCs are embedded into modules and assemblies. This pushes equipment providers to improve classification confidence through better illumination models, multi-angle capture, and machine learning approaches that reduce false positives without sacrificing detection of critical defects.

Finally, the buyer’s evaluation criteria are shifting toward resilience and lifecycle support. Global supply volatility, component lead-time uncertainty, and rising compliance expectations have increased scrutiny on spare parts availability, remote diagnostics, software update cadence, cybersecurity, and the ability to maintain consistent performance across plants. Consequently, differentiation is moving away from single-feature superiority and toward end-to-end reliability, service infrastructure, and proven deployment methodologies that shorten time-to-value.

United States tariffs in 2025 are reshaping procurement, localization, and supplier strategies, elevating resilience and cost transparency in tool selection

United States tariff actions in 2025 have reinforced a cautious and strategic posture among buyers of FPC visual inspection equipment and the broader electronics manufacturing ecosystem. Even when tariff applicability varies by country of origin, equipment category, or component classification, the operational effect is consistent: procurement teams are building higher friction into purchasing decisions and tightening approval processes around capital equipment that could be exposed to policy-driven cost shifts.

One immediate impact is a stronger preference for diversified sourcing and configurable bills of materials. Equipment suppliers that can demonstrate alternate component options, multi-region manufacturing capability, or flexible final-assembly locations are better positioned to reduce perceived exposure. In parallel, buyers are asking for clearer documentation of origin, harmonized classification support, and contracting structures that share or cap certain tariff-related risks.

Another significant effect is the acceleration of localization strategies. As manufacturers evaluate where to place new FPC capacity, inspection equipment is being assessed not only for performance but also for service proximity, parts logistics, and the ability to support rapid ramp in new geographies. This has elevated the importance of local field application engineering, regional calibration services, and training programs that can sustain process stability without constant overseas support.

Moreover, tariffs influence technology roadmaps indirectly by reshaping budget allocations. When total acquisition costs rise, buyers tend to demand faster returns through higher utilization, broader defect coverage per tool, and software features that reduce labor intensity. This dynamic strengthens the business case for platforms that consolidate inspection steps, enable faster recipe creation for high-mix portfolios, and provide robust data pipelines that reduce time spent chasing false calls.

Over time, tariffs can also change competitive dynamics by encouraging strategic partnerships, joint ventures, or regional manufacturing footprints among equipment providers. For end users, the practical implication is that vendor evaluation must include policy resilience, contractual clarity, and supply continuity-alongside optical performance and detection capability.

Segmentation reveals that inspection priorities diverge by process step, automation approach, deployment format, application rigor, and production scale realities

Segmentation insight begins with the recognition that inspection needs differ sharply depending on where the tool sits in the FPC process flow and what defect classes dominate risk. In systems positioned for pre-lamination inspection, buyers typically prioritize rapid detection of conductor pattern issues, etch non-uniformity, and contamination that can be trapped later. In contrast, post-lamination and coverlay-focused inspection emphasizes registration accuracy, adhesive voids, coverlay misalignment, and surface artifacts that may correlate with long-term reliability under flexing.

From a technology perspective, the market divides meaningfully by inspection approach, including automated optical inspection, manual visual inspection aids, and hybrid workflows that combine operator judgment with automated highlighting. Automated optical inspection continues to gain share in high-throughput operations, but hybrid setups remain important where high-mix complexity, frequent design changes, or nuanced cosmetic criteria make purely automated classification difficult. This is especially evident when factories must manage both electrical-critical defects and appearance-driven acceptance standards for consumer-facing applications.

Equipment adoption also varies by deployment format and level of integration. Inline inspection tends to be favored by producers aiming to reduce WIP and shorten feedback cycles, while offline or nearline inspection remains relevant when floor constraints, line balancing, or step-specific imaging requirements complicate full integration. As factories pursue smarter manufacturing programs, the difference increasingly hinges on data orchestration and how seamlessly the tool connects to quality databases, traceability systems, and process equipment.

Application-driven segmentation reveals distinct performance priorities. Consumer electronics pushes for high throughput, quick changeover, and strong cosmetic inspection to meet brand expectations. Automotive and industrial use cases intensify demands for defect traceability, audit-ready records, and long-term reliability screening, often encouraging stricter classification thresholds and more conservative acceptance criteria. Medical and aerospace-adjacent production, where applicable, further reinforces documentation, validation discipline, and repeatability as decision-making anchors.

Finally, segmentation by end-user scale and production model shapes buying behavior. High-volume manufacturers tend to standardize on platforms that deliver repeatability and allow recipe portability across sites, while specialized or prototyping-oriented producers value flexibility, faster setup, and the ability to inspect novel structures without extensive engineering effort. Across these segments, the winning solutions are those that align optics, software, and workflow design to the defect economics of the specific production reality rather than relying on generic detection claims.

Regional insights highlight how the Americas, Europe, Middle East & Africa, and Asia-Pacific prioritize inspection through different lenses of risk and capability

Regional dynamics reflect where FPC capacity is concentrated, how supply chains are structured, and how regulatory and customer requirements influence inspection rigor. In the Americas, investment attention often centers on supply chain resilience, reshoring or nearshoring strategies, and the ability to support advanced electronics programs with consistent documentation. Buyers in this region frequently emphasize service responsiveness, spare-parts reliability, and the integration of inspection outputs into factory-wide quality systems, especially where production is distributed across multiple sites.

Across Europe, the quality narrative is strongly shaped by compliance expectations, automotive and industrial reliability standards, and a preference for rigorous validation practices. Inspection equipment decisions often lean toward repeatability, traceability, and a disciplined approach to change control. As a result, software governance, audit trails, and long-term calibration stability can weigh as heavily as raw imaging performance.

The Middle East and Africa region presents a different profile, where electronics manufacturing ecosystems are developing unevenly across countries and industrial zones. Here, inspection investments frequently align with broader industrial diversification goals, capacity building, and workforce enablement. Training, local service support, and robust ease-of-use become crucial adoption factors, particularly when manufacturers are building inspection competence alongside new production lines.

Asia-Pacific remains central to FPC production and innovation, with strong momentum in high-volume consumer electronics as well as increasingly sophisticated automotive and industrial applications. High-mix manufacturing, rapid design refresh cycles, and intense cost and throughput pressures make recipe agility, false-call control, and uptime critical. In many APAC hubs, competition pushes manufacturers to adopt inspection systems that can support fast ramp and continuous improvement, using analytics to elevate yield and reduce rework.

Taken together, these regional patterns show that the same inspection platform can be evaluated through different lenses. In some regions, service footprint and policy resilience dominate early screening, while in others, advanced automation and data integration define competitiveness. Vendors that localize support capabilities and align their product configuration to regional production realities are positioned to win more consistently across global deployments.

Company competition increasingly hinges on imaging innovation, AI-driven classification, integration ecosystems, and field-proven deployment support

Company strategies in FPC visual inspection equipment increasingly cluster around three differentiators: imaging depth, software intelligence, and deployment support. Leading suppliers are expanding beyond standard brightfield optics toward configurable illumination, higher-resolution sensors, and multi-angle capture to address difficult surfaces and reflective materials common in flexible circuits. This is paired with mechanical stability improvements that preserve measurement repeatability even as line speeds rise and substrates exhibit variability.

On the software side, competition is intensifying around defect classification robustness and the ability to manage high-mix programs. Vendors are investing in AI-assisted tuning, defect library management, and workflow features that reduce engineering burden during new product introduction. Just as important, suppliers are strengthening their data models so inspection outputs can be mined for trend detection, linked to upstream tool conditions, and used to accelerate corrective action cycles.

Service and enablement have become decisive in many competitive bids. Buyers are increasingly skeptical of “spec-sheet wins” that fail to translate into stable factory performance. As a result, suppliers with mature application engineering, proven recipe development playbooks, and structured training programs are gaining advantage. Remote diagnostics, software update governance, and cybersecurity readiness also matter more as inspection tools become more connected to enterprise networks.

Partnership ecosystems are another visible trend. Equipment providers are collaborating more frequently with MES vendors, traceability platforms, and upstream process tool manufacturers to deliver tighter integration and faster time-to-value. Meanwhile, some companies are tailoring offerings for specific FPC segments, such as bend-critical designs, fine-line patterns, or coverlay-heavy structures, recognizing that specialized defect modes can demand customized optics and algorithms.

Overall, the company landscape rewards those that can pair credible detection performance with operational excellence-meaning the ability to deploy quickly, maintain stability, and continuously improve classification in live production without excessive downtime or rework escalation.

Actionable recommendations emphasize defect-economics alignment, recipe agility, tariff-resilient sourcing, and inspection data as a continuous improvement engine

Industry leaders can strengthen their inspection strategy by aligning equipment selection with defect economics and process risk rather than relying on generic sensitivity claims. This starts with a disciplined mapping of critical-to-quality features across the FPC lifecycle, tying each to likely defect mechanisms and identifying the inspection step where intervention is most cost-effective. By doing so, teams can avoid over-inspecting low-risk attributes while ensuring bend-zone reliability risks, registration failures, and contamination pathways receive the necessary scrutiny.

To improve throughput without sacrificing quality, leaders should prioritize recipe agility and false-call governance. That includes formalizing how golden samples are created, how defect libraries are curated, and how classification thresholds are tuned as materials, suppliers, and designs change. Where AI is deployed, organizations should establish validation protocols and drift monitoring so model performance remains stable over time and across sites.

Operational resilience should be treated as a core purchasing criterion. Procurement and engineering teams can reduce tariff and supply uncertainty by evaluating vendors on multi-region supportability, parts availability, and contractual clarity around policy-related cost exposure. In parallel, standardizing on a limited set of platforms-when feasible-can simplify spares, training, and recipe portability while improving negotiation leverage.

Leaders should also elevate inspection data into a continuous improvement asset. Integrating inspection results with process parameters, maintenance records, and yield analytics enables faster root-cause isolation and more targeted corrective actions. Over time, this supports a transition from reactive quality control to predictive quality management, where emerging defect patterns are identified early and addressed before they escalate into customer escapes.

Finally, investing in people and change management remains essential. Even the best inspection equipment underperforms if operators, engineers, and quality teams do not share consistent definitions of defects, escalation rules, and response playbooks. Structured training, cross-functional review routines, and clear ownership of recipe governance can turn inspection from a bottleneck into a competitive capability.
